526. Is There One Who Feels Unworthy?

Text Information
First Line: Is there one who feels unworthy?
Title: Is There One Who Feels Unworthy?
Author: Ken Medema, 1943- (2009)
Refrain First Line: Here in this holy place
Meter: 8.7.8.7.D. and refrain
Language: English
Publication Date: 2013
Scripture:
Topic: Brokenness; Communion; Compassion (8 more...)
Copyright: © 2009 Ken Medema Music/Brier Patch Music
Notes: Composed with youth at Community of Christ International Youth Forum, 2009
Tune Information
Name: [Is there one who feels unworthy]
Composer: Ken Medema, 1943-
Meter: 8.7.8.7.D. and refrain
Key: F Major or modal
Copyright: © 2009 Ken Medema Music/Brier Patch Music
